纵观计算机科学的发展史,其边界由一代代天才学者与工程师不断拓展。
要回答“最强的计算机相关人士在哪里、是谁”,需从奠基性的理论先驱和定义当代范式的研究领袖两个维度审视。
他们通常被称为“XX之父”,其贡献构成了我们今天数字世界的基石。以下表格梳理了从基础理论到前沿应用的“最强”人物谱系及其核心贡献。
| 领域/称号 | 核心人物 | 所在机构/国家(代表性) | 核心贡献与影响 |
|---|---|---|---|
| 计算机科学之父 / 人工智能之父 | 艾伦·图灵 | 英国(剑桥大学、曼彻斯特大学) | 提出图灵机数学模型,为可计算性理论奠基;提出图灵测试,为人工智能划定哲学与工程目标;二战期间领导破译德国Enigma密码,直接缩短战争进程。 |
| 现代计算机体系结构之父 | 约翰·冯·诺依曼 | 美国(普林斯顿高等研究院) | 提出“存储程序”概念,即冯·诺依曼体系结构,明确计算机由运算器、控制器、存储器、输入输出设备组成,程序与数据统一存储。该架构至今仍是几乎所有通用计算机的设计蓝图。 |
| 电子计算机之父 | 约翰·阿坦那索夫 | 美国(艾奥瓦州立大学) | 与克利福德·贝瑞于1939年制造了ABC计算机,这是公认的第一台电子计算机,首次采用二进制、电子逻辑电路和可刷新电容存储器,奠定了电子计算的基础。 |
| 互联网之父 | 文顿·瑟夫 & 罗伯特·卡恩 | 美国(DARPA、谷歌/CNRI) | 共同设计了TCP/IP协议,这是互联网通信的基础协议套件,定义了数据如何在全球网络中打包、寻址、传输和接收。瑟夫和卡恩因此被称为“互联网之父”。 |
| 万维网之父 | 蒂姆·伯纳斯-李 | 英国/欧洲核子研究中心 | 发明了万维网,包括HTTP协议、HTML语言和第一个Web浏览器,将互联网从学术工具转变为全球信息共享平台,并坚持使其成为免费开放的标准。 |
| 个人计算机革命之父 | 史蒂夫·乔布斯 & 史蒂夫·沃兹尼亚克 | 美国(苹果公司) | 沃兹尼亚克设计了Apple I和Apple II,定义了早期个人电脑的硬件典范;乔布斯则以其产品美学和市场远见,推动了个人电脑的大众化普及,开启了个人计算时代。 |
| 自由软件运动之父 / GNU项目发起人 | 理查德·斯托曼 | 美国(自由软件基金会) | 发起GNU项目,旨在创建一个完全自由的操作系统;起草GNU通用公共许可证,确立了“Copyleft”理念,为开源运动奠定了法律和哲学基础。 |
| Linux之父 | 林纳斯·托瓦兹 | 芬兰/美国 | 开发了Linux内核,并将其开源。Linux内核与GNU项目软件结合,形成了GNU/Linux操作系统,成为服务器、超级计算机、安卓系统及无数嵌入式设备的基石,是开源协作的典范。 |
| 深度学习之父 / 神经网络复兴的关键人物 | 杰弗里·辛顿 & 约书亚·本吉奥 & 杨立昆 | 加拿大/美国(多伦多大学/蒙特利尔大学/脸书) | 辛顿、本吉奥和杨立昆(Yann LeCun)在神经网络低潮期坚持研究。辛顿团队2012年凭借AlexNet在ImageNet竞赛中引发深度学习革命;本吉奥在序列建模(如RNN)贡献卓著;杨立昆发明了卷积神经网络,是计算机视觉的基石。三人共获2018年图灵奖。 |
| 实用化密码学与区块链之父(化名) | 中本聪 | 未知 | 2008年发表《比特币:一种点对点的电子现金系统》白皮书,创造了比特币及其底层技术区块链。他整合了密码学哈希函数、工作量证明共识机制和点对点网络,开创了去中心化数字货币和分布式账本技术的全新领域。 |
一、理论奠基者:从“可计算”到“可构建”
计算机的诞生并非一蹴而就,其思想源头可追溯至数理逻辑。艾伦·图灵是这个源头最耀眼的星辰。
他的伟大在于,在电子计算机尚未成形的1936年,就用纯粹的数学思维——图灵机——定义了“计算”本身的极限。图灵机并非一台具体的机器,而是一个抽象的模型,它证明了一个简单到只有读写头、无限长纸带和状态表的装置,就能模拟任何逻辑过程。
这解决了“哪些问题是可计算的”这一根本问题,划定了计算机能力的理论边界。二战期间,他在布莱切利园领导破译Enigma密码的实践,则是理论指导实践、拯救万千生命的史诗。他晚年提出的“图灵测试”,至今仍是衡量机器智能的经典标尺。因此,称他为“计算机科学之父”与“人工智能之父”毫不为过。
理论需要落地为工程。尽管第一台电子计算机ABC由约翰·阿坦那索夫发明,但真正塑造了现代计算机“身体结构”的,是约翰·冯·诺依曼。
他的核心贡献在于一份名为《关于EDVAC的报告草案》的101页报告,其中系统阐述了冯·诺依曼体系结构:计算机应由五大部件(运算器、控制器、存储器、输入设备、输出设备)构成,且程序和数据应以二进制形式存储在同一个存储器中,按顺序执行。
这一设计将计算机从为解决特定问题而重新布线的“计算器”,变成了通过更换存储的程序就能解决任何问题的“通用机器”。今天,无论是你口袋里的手机还是天河超级计算机,其灵魂依然是冯·诺依曼架构。
幽默视角:图灵和冯·诺依曼的关系,好比一位是定义了“房屋可以建成什么样”的建筑理论家,另一位则是制定了“所有房屋都应包含地基、墙体、屋顶和管道”的通用建筑规范的工程师。前者描绘了可能性,后者则让大规模、标准化建造成为现实。
二、连接世界者:从“实验室网络”到“全球网格”
计算机单体强大之后,连接成为必然。文顿·瑟夫和罗伯特·卡恩的贡献在于为这种连接制定了“世界语”——TCP/IP协议。在70年代,他们面临的问题是:如何让不同架构、不同操作系统的计算机可靠地交换信息?他们的解决方案分两层:IP协议负责给每台设备一个唯一地址(如同门牌号)并负责寻址和路由;TCP协议则负责将数据分割成包、确保其按序到达、并处理丢失重传(如同负责打包、运输和验收的物流公司)。这一设计优雅地实现了网络的鲁棒性和可扩展性,是互联网得以爆炸式增长的技术基石。
如果说TCP/IP是互联网的“公路系统”,那么蒂姆·伯纳斯-李发明的万维网就是在公路上跑的“汽车、商店和图书馆”。他在欧洲核子研究中心工作期间,为了便于物理学家共享文档,设计了一个基于超文本的系统。他创造了三个关键要素:HTTP(超文本传输协议,定义了浏览器与服务器如何通信)、HTML(超文本标记语言,定义了网页内容的结构)和URL(统一资源定位符,定义了网络资源的地址)。最重要的是,他拒绝将万维网专利化,坚持其开放标准,使得任何人都可以自由地创建网站和浏览器,从而引爆了信息革命。
# 一个极简的比喻,说明TCP/IP和万维网的关系
# TCP/IP 层:负责可靠的数据传输
def tcp_ip_send(data, destination_ip):
# 1. TCP:将数据分块,编号,确保可靠传输
packets = split_and_number_data(data)
for packet in packets:
# 2. IP:添加地址,进行路由
routed_packet = add_ip_header(packet, destination_ip)
send_over_network(routed_packet)
# 3. TCP:在目的地重组数据,确认接收
reassembled_data = receive_and_reassemble(destination_ip)
return reassembled_data
# 万维网 应用层:在可靠传输之上构建有意义的内容
def web_browse(url):
# 1. 根据URL,通过HTTP协议请求一个HTML文档
html_document = http_request(url)
# 2. 浏览器解析HTML,渲染成用户看到的页面
rendered_page = browser_render(html_document)
return rendered_page
# 用户使用流程:万维网建立在TCP/IP的可靠通道之上
user_request = “获取知乎首页”
reliable_data_pipe = tcp_ip_send(user_request, “www.zhihu.com”) # 底层TCP/IP保障通道
web_page = web_browse(reliable_data_pipe) # 上层万维网提供内容
三、软件与生态构建者:从“专有堡垒”到“开源大陆”
硬件和网络是骨架,软件与生态则是血肉与灵魂。在这一领域,有两位“史蒂夫”和两位“开源巨匠”影响至深。
史蒂夫·沃兹尼亚克和史蒂夫·乔布斯让计算机“个人化”。沃兹尼亚克是天才工程师,他设计的Apple II以其简洁、可靠和可扩展性,成为第一款取得巨大商业成功的个人电脑。乔布斯则以其对用户体验的极致追求和营销天赋,将苹果产品塑造成了文化符号。他们的贡献在于让计算机从机构走入家庭和个人手中,点燃了大众数字革命的引信。
与此同时,理查德·斯托曼发起了反对软件私有化的哲学运动。他认为软件应该像思想一样自由。为此,他启动了GNU项目,旨在创建一个完全由自由软件组成的类Unix操作系统。他为自由软件运动铸造了法律武器——GPL许可证,其“反版权”的“传染性”条款,确保了自由软件的开源属性能在其衍生作品中得到延续。如果没有GPL,后来的Linux可能只是一个个人爱好项目。
林纳斯·托瓦兹则用行动证明了全球协作开发复杂系统(Linux内核)的可行性。他高效且开放的管理风格,吸引了全球成千上万的开发者贡献代码,使得Linux在性能、稳定性和安全性上迅速超越了许多商业操作系统,成为互联网基础设施的“沉默的统治者”。Android系统基于Linux内核,全球绝大多数服务器、超级计算机也运行着Linux,其影响力无处不在。
四、智能时代的引路人:从“人工规则”到“数据驱动”
进入21世纪,人工智能,特别是深度学习,成为计算机领域最前沿的浪潮。其复兴的关键在于杰弗里·辛顿、约书亚·本吉奥和杨立昆三位先驱数十年如一日的坚持。在神经网络因算力不足、理论瓶颈而被主流抛弃的“AI寒冬”里,他们仍然相信连接主义的方向。
- 杨立昆:他在80年代末90年代初发明了卷积神经网络,这是一种受生物视觉皮层启发的网络结构,能高效处理图像等网格化数据,是今天所有计算机视觉应用(如人脸识别、自动驾驶)的核心。
- 杰弗里·辛顿:他与学生Alex Krizhevsky和Ilya Sutskever在2012年ImageNet竞赛中推出的AlexNet,首次大幅领先传统方法,震惊业界。他们成功的关键在于使用GPU进行大规模训练,并采用了有效的正则化方法(如Dropout),证明了深度神经网络的巨大潜力。
- 约书亚·本吉奥:他在序列建模和表征学习方面贡献巨大,其工作在自然语言处理领域影响深远,为后来的RNN、LSTM乃至Transformer模型奠定了基础。
他们的工作共同促成了深度学习的“寒武纪大爆发”,让机器从“听从指令”走向“从数据中学习”,彻底改变了人工智能的发展轨迹。
五、范式颠覆者:从“中心化信任”到“去中心化共识”
最后,一位神秘人物以一篇论文开创了一个全新领域。中本聪(身份至今成谜)在2008年金融危机后发布的比特币白皮书,不仅仅创造了一种数字货币,更重要的是其底层技术——区块链。它通过工作量证明共识机制、密码学哈希链和点对点网络,首次在数字世界实现了在无需可信第三方的情况下,达成全局一致性。这为解决分布式系统中的“拜占庭将军问题”提供了工程实践,其意义远超金融范畴,正在重塑我们对数据所有权、价值传递和组织协作方式的认知。
结论: 这些“最强”的人物,分布在学术界(图灵、冯·诺依曼、深度学习三巨头)、工业界(乔布斯、沃兹尼亚克、伯纳斯-李)以及模糊的边界地带(斯托曼、托瓦兹、中本聪)。
他们的共同点是,都以划时代的思想或发明,重新定义了计算机“能做什么”和“如何去做”的边界。
从图灵的可计算理论,到冯·诺依曼的通用架构,再到TCP/IP的互联协议、万维网的开放信息访问、个人计算的普及、开源协作的模式、数据驱动的智能,以及去中心化的信任机制——他们接力构建了我们今天所处的数字文明。他们的工作地点或许各异,但他们的遗产,共同构成了全球互联、智能普惠的数字世界的基石与蓝图。